WebMar 4, 2024 · A rabbet joint is stronger than a typical butt joint—which is simply two straight edges joined together—because a rabbet provides more of a mechanical connection. WebDec 7, 2014 · Given the wide variety of choices and consumer needs, prosthetists and rehabilitation specialists can help amputees choose the best prosthetic knees for their … WebJun 8, 2024 · Though the swivel's ball bearings do most of the mechanical work, the most important part of the swivel joint is arguably the liquid-tight pressure seal that retains the pressurized working fluid. Pressure seals can be made from thermoplastics such as PTFE, and from elastomers such as FKM and nitrile rubber. WebMechanical Knees.
